博客 RPO/RTO技术实现与数据恢复方案解析

RPO/RTO技术实现与数据恢复方案解析

   数栈君   发表于 2026-01-02 10:15  159  0

在数字化转型的浪潮中,企业对数据的依赖程度日益增加。数据中台、数字孪生和数字可视化等技术的应用,使得数据成为企业决策和运营的核心资产。然而,数据的丢失或损坏可能对企业造成巨大的经济损失和声誉损害。因此,如何确保数据的高可用性和快速恢复成为企业 IT 管理的重要课题。RPO(Recovery Point Objective)和 RTO(Recovery Time Objective)是衡量数据保护和恢复能力的关键指标。本文将深入解析 RPO/RTO 的技术实现与数据恢复方案,帮助企业制定有效的数据保护策略。


什么是 RPO 和 RTO?

RPO 和 RTO 是数据保护领域中的两个重要概念,它们分别定义了数据恢复的目标和时间要求。

  • RPO(Recovery Point Objective):表示在发生数据丢失时,系统能够容忍的数据丢失量。RPO 的目标是将数据丢失控制在可接受的范围内,例如几秒或几分钟内。RPO 越小,数据丢失的风险越低。

  • RTO(Recovery Time Objective):表示在发生故障时,系统能够容忍的停机时间。RTO 的目标是将系统恢复时间控制在可接受的范围内,例如几分钟或几小时内。RTO 越小,系统的可用性越高。

RPO 和 RTO 的设定需要根据企业的业务需求和数据的重要性来确定。例如,对于金融行业,RPO 和 RTO 的要求通常非常严格,因为任何数据丢失或停机都可能带来巨大的经济损失。


RPO/RTO 的技术实现

为了实现 RPO 和 RTO 的目标,企业需要采用多种技术手段来确保数据的高可用性和快速恢复能力。以下是常见的 RPO/RTO 技术实现方法:

1. 数据备份与恢复

数据备份是 RPO/RTO 实现的基础。通过定期备份数据,企业可以在发生数据丢失时快速恢复数据。常见的备份策略包括:

  • 全量备份:定期备份所有数据,适用于数据量较小的场景。
  • 增量备份:仅备份自上次备份以来发生变化的数据,节省存储空间和备份时间。
  • 差异备份:备份自上次全量备份以来发生变化的数据,比增量备份更高效。

此外,备份数据需要存储在安全的存储介质中,例如磁带、云存储或异地服务器。备份数据的存储位置也需要考虑 RPO 的要求,例如将备份数据存储在多个地理位置,以降低自然灾害或人为错误导致的备份数据丢失风险。

2. 冗余存储与高可用架构

为了降低数据丢失的风险,企业可以采用冗余存储技术。冗余存储通过将数据复制到多个存储设备或存储位置,确保在某个存储设备故障时,数据仍然可以访问。

此外,高可用架构(HA)是实现 RTO 目标的重要手段。高可用架构通过使用冗余服务器、网络和存储设备,确保在单点故障发生时,系统可以自动切换到备用设备,从而减少停机时间。

3. 数据同步与复制

数据同步与复制技术可以实时或准实时地将数据同步到多个位置,例如本地数据中心和云存储。这种技术可以确保在主数据中心发生故障时,数据仍然可以在备用数据中心访问,从而实现快速恢复。

4. 监控与告警

实时监控和告警系统是 RPO/RTO 实现的重要组成部分。通过监控系统的运行状态,企业可以在故障发生时快速发现并响应。例如,当检测到存储设备故障时,系统可以立即触发告警,并自动启动恢复流程。


数据恢复方案解析

数据恢复方案是实现 RPO/RTO 的关键步骤。以下是几种常见的数据恢复方案:

1. 灾难恢复计划(DRP)

灾难恢复计划是企业在发生重大故障或灾难时的应对策略。DRP 包括数据备份、冗余存储、备用数据中心等技术手段,以及详细的恢复流程和应急响应计划。DRP 的目标是在灾难发生时,尽可能快速地恢复数据和系统,以满足 RTO 和 RPO 的要求。

2. 数据镜像与快照

数据镜像和快照技术可以提供快速的数据恢复能力。数据镜像是将数据实时复制到另一个存储设备,而快照则是将数据在某个时间点的状态保存下来。当数据丢失或损坏时,可以通过镜像或快照快速恢复数据。

3. 云存储与备份

云存储和备份技术为企业提供了灵活的数据存储和恢复方案。通过将数据备份到云存储,企业可以在需要时快速恢复数据。云存储的高可用性和弹性扩展能力,使得云备份成为实现 RPO/RTO 的理想选择。

4. 数据脱机恢复

在某些情况下,数据恢复需要将系统脱机进行修复。例如,当数据损坏严重时,可能需要从备份中恢复数据,并重新部署系统。这种恢复方式虽然耗时较长,但在某些场景下是必要的。


如何选择适合的 RPO/RTO 方案?

选择适合的 RPO/RTO 方案需要综合考虑企业的业务需求、数据的重要性、预算和资源等因素。以下是一些关键考虑因素:

  1. 业务连续性:企业的业务连续性需求决定了 RTO 和 RPO 的目标。例如,金融行业通常需要更高的 RTO 和 RPO 要求。

  2. 数据的重要性:关键业务数据需要更高的 RPO 和 RTO 保护,而次要数据可以适当放宽要求。

  3. 成本与资源:高 RPO/RTO 要求通常需要更多的资源和更高的成本。企业需要在成本和保护水平之间找到平衡点。

  4. 技术可行性:选择 RPO/RTO 方案时,需要考虑技术的可行性和实施难度。例如,云备份技术的实施可能需要一定的网络和存储资源。


结论

RPO 和 RTO 是衡量数据保护和恢复能力的重要指标。通过采用数据备份、冗余存储、高可用架构等技术手段,企业可以实现 RPO 和 RTO 的目标,确保数据的高可用性和快速恢复能力。同时,制定详细的灾难恢复计划和监控告警系统,也是实现 RPO/RTO 的关键步骤。

对于数据中台、数字孪生和数字可视化等技术的应用,RPO/RTO 的实现尤为重要。这些技术依赖于实时数据的处理和展示,任何数据丢失或停机都可能影响企业的业务运营。因此,企业需要根据自身的业务需求和数据特点,选择适合的 RPO/RTO 方案,以确保数据的安全和系统的稳定运行。

如果您对我们的解决方案感兴趣,欢迎申请试用:申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料